Almost sure bounds for a weighted Steinhaus random multiplicative function

Number Theory 2025-11-10 v1

Abstract

We obtain almost sure bounds for the weighted sum ntf(n)n\sum_{n \leq t} \frac{f(n)}{\sqrt{n}}, where f(n)f(n) is a Steinhaus random multiplicative function. Specifically, we obtain the bounds predicted by exponentiating the law of the iterated logarithm, giving sharp upper and lower bounds.
